Local 15 - Nutrien Bargaining - Jan. 7 & 8
GSU's collective agreements  with Nutrien expire Dec. 31, 2019. Your  GSU Local 15 bargaining committee members are Brian Cowen, Curtis Cousins, Lynn Shaw, GSU staff rep Steve Torgerson, and GSU staff rep/bargaining spokesperson Dale Markling.

Local 5 - Western Producer bargaining - Saskatoon, Jan. 14
The sudden illness of a committee member on Nov. 26 postponed the scheduled Local 5 (Western Producer) bargaining session. GSU's bargaining committee members are Sharlene Tetrault, Michelle Houlden, and GSU staff rep/bargaining spokesperson Dale Markling 

GSU biennial convention - Temple Gardens, Moose Jaw, March 19-21, 2020
We are counting on GSU members - like you - to come to convention, share your thoughts and experiences, and let us know what you think your union should be doing for members.  Registration will open, soon.  All members of GSU are eligible to attend, but space is limited.

Tips for managing your stress over the holidays

Freshly fallen snow, food, gifts, family and friends. Sounds like it should be wonderful, and for many people it is. For others, the stress surrounding travel, groups of people, peer pressure presents, and family tensions is overwhelming. 

Take a deep breath, free your self from expectations, and just enjoy your time. Life is seldom perfect and we shouldn't expect the holidays to be perfect, either.
